The basic idea in this redesign is to add an eviction fence only in UQ resume path. When userqueue is not present, keep ev_fence as NULL Main changes are: - do not create the eviction fence during evf_mgr_init, keeping evf_mgr->ev_fence=NULL until UQ get active. - do not replace the ev_fence in evf_resume path, but replace it only in uq_resume path, so remove all the unnecessary code from ev_fence_resume. - add a new helper function (amdgpu_userqueue_ensure_ev_fence) which will do the following: - flush any pending uq_resume work, so that it could create an eviction_fence - if there is no pending uq_resume_work, add a uq_resume work and wait for it to execute so that we always have a valid ev_fence - call this helper function from two places, to ensure we have a valid ev_fence: - when a new uq is created - when a new uq completion fence is created v2: Worked on review comments by Christian. v3: Addressed few more review comments by Christian. v4: Move mutex lock outside of the amdgpu_userqueue_suspend() function (Christian). v5: squash in build fix (Alex) Cc: Alex Deucher <alexander.deucher@amd.com> Reviewed-by: Christian König <christian.koenig@amd.com> Signed-off-by: Arvind Yadav <arvind.yadav@amd.com> Signed-off-by: Shashank Sharma <shashank.sharma@amd.com> Signed-off-by: Alex Deucher <alexander.deucher@amd.com>
